The Miles Davis Jazz Studies Program celebrates Miles Davis in his centennial year! Jazz Ensemble II presents “Directions: Electric Miles,” a program of Mr. Davis’ electric music from the years spanning 1968–91, in all-new arrangements! Davis’ trailblazing spirit made an indelible mark on the history of American music, and the Jazz Studies program dedicates their spring 2026 semester to his musical legacy.

The Percussion Ensemble is partnering with the Spartan Open Pantry to collect canned goods or other non-perishable items at this performance. Please bring any items you would like to donate. The Spartan Open Pantry is a food pantry for UNC Greensboro students, staff, and recent alumni struggling to afford to eat.

The Miles Davis Jazz Studies Program rounds out the year with jazz bassist, composer, arranger, and producer John Clayton. A GRAMMY® winner with nine additional nominations and has written and/or recorded with artists such as Milt Jackson, Diana Krall, Paul McCartney, Regina Carter, Dee Dee Bridgewater, Gladys Knight, Queen Latifah, McCoy Tyner, YoYo Ma, and Charles Aznavour, to name only a few.
